Codeczar Java Web Components are complete solutions to common software problems such as Security, Logging, News, Email, Templating etc.
Whilst many excellent third-party utilities exist, many of them require significant effort to integrate with your applications. Codeczar Components simplify this process.

What is a Codeczar Component?
Every codeczar component has the following features:
- intuitive and audit-friendly administration interface
- the utility itself - a third-party tool such as Log4j or a codeczar utility e.g. cz-news
- persistence - save and retrieve your application data (e.g. log4j config, news items)
- extras - to make your life easier - utilities, taglibs, example code....
At codeczar we do not believe in re-inventing the wheel, where a de facto industry standard exists, we use it. Where no such standard exists, we provide the complete end-to-end solution.

The Components
| component | description | third-party | status |
|---|---|---|---|
| logweb | runtime log4j configuration | log4j | 3.0 |
| configuration | manage application configuration | jakarta commons-configuration | 1.1 |
| internationalisation | manage i18n content | apache-struts & jstl fmt | pre-release |
| security | users, groups, roles, password, forgotten password, hints | codeczar security | pre-release |
| preferences | user preferences | codeczar preferences | pre-release |
| templates | mail-merge, product mail shots, sms | apache velocity | pre-release |
| mailing lists, groups, mail-shots, subscriptions | codeczar-mailer | pre-release | |
| news | manage rss & atom news content | codeczar news | pre-release |
| commerce | products, shopping basket, checkout, invoice, payment | codeczar commerce | pre-release |
| events | event calendar, notifications | codeczar events | pre-release |
| rental | resources, calendar, time-slots, charging | codeczar rental | pre-release |
| ticketing | events, times, tickets, seats, charging | codeczar ticketing | pre-release |
